Your key responsibilities will be:
- Seasonal plan development: Develop, inform, and influence seasonal plans based on a rolling SSP (including retail sales value/units, receipts, and inventory) at the Franchise/Merch Class x Sports x Marketplace unit levels.
- OTB & strategy ownership: Own the product-driven Open-to-Buy (OTB) forecast to inform manufacturing decisions through to in-season optimization, driving strategies to meet Sports Offense strategic and financial goals.
- Business analysis & optimization: Analyze weekly and monthly business performance against plans and forecasts. Assess risks and opportunities, develop action plans, and drive necessary escalations.
- Inventory health management: Set and manage end-to-end inventory health within and across categories and NMP MPUs, while understanding the broader impact on overall marketplace health.
- Cross-functional leadership: Communicate and advocate the Assortment Plan to the cross-functional leadership team. Partner closely with Sales to optimize sell-in aligned with the MPU strategy.
- Project management: Independently drive and prioritize projects, workloads, and key deliverables within the team.
